Cătălin Drulă, the USR candidate for the Capital City Hall, voted on Sunday morning, expressing his optimism regarding the future of the city. He emphasized the importance of the elections, stating that Bucharest needs 'a new beginning' and a dedicated administration for major projects. Drulă urged Bucharesters to mobilize and vote, mentioning that the future of the Capital depends on the involvement of voters. Among his priorities for the new administration are a fair budget, the development of transport and heating networks, as well as coherent urban planning. Cătălin Drulă stated that the old problems of the city can be solved and that Bucharest has the potential to start a new stage of development. He voted alongside his children, remaining full of optimism on election day.
